华为云服务器怎么使用cloud shell登录方式,华为云服务器怎么使用
- 综合资讯
- 2024-10-02 03:47:39
- 3

***:本文主要涉及华为云服务器的使用相关内容,重点聚焦于cloud shell登录方式。但未详细阐述使用华为云服务器的其他方面内容,主要探讨如何通过cloud she...
***:主要讲述华为云服务器相关内容,重点提及了华为云服务器使用cloud shell登录方式的疑问,同时也对华为云服务器的使用存在疑问。但文档未给出具体如何使用cloud shell登录华为云服务器以及华为云服务器使用的详细步骤等内容,整体围绕对华为云服务器登录与使用方面的疑惑展开。
本文目录导读:
《华为云服务器Cloud Shell登录方式全解析与使用指南》
华为云服务器简介
华为云服务器是华为云提供的一种云计算服务,它为用户提供了可弹性扩展的计算资源,能够满足不同规模企业和开发者的需求,无论是构建网站、运行企业应用程序还是进行大数据分析等任务,华为云服务器都能提供稳定、高效的计算支持。
Cloud Shell概述
1、什么是Cloud Shell
- Cloud Shell是华为云提供的一种在线的、基于浏览器的命令行工具,它无需用户在本地安装专门的SSH客户端等工具,直接通过浏览器就可以访问和操作云服务器。
- 这种方式具有便捷性,用户可以随时随地登录到云服务器进行管理操作,只要有网络连接和浏览器即可。
2、Cloud Shell的优势
免安装
- 与传统的登录方式不同,不需要在本地设备上安装复杂的SSH工具,对于一些受限制的工作环境,如无法安装额外软件的办公电脑或者移动设备,Cloud Shell提供了极大的便利。
安全可靠
- Cloud Shell通过华为云的安全机制进行身份验证和数据传输保护,它集成了华为云的安全策略,如多因素身份验证等,确保只有授权用户能够访问云服务器,并且在数据传输过程中采用加密技术,防止数据泄露。
资源隔离
- 每个用户的Cloud Shell环境是相互隔离的,这意味着不同用户在使用Cloud Shell登录自己的云服务器时,不会相互干扰,保证了操作的独立性和安全性。
三、使用Cloud Shell登录华为云服务器的准备工作
1、注册华为云账号
- 如果还没有华为云账号,需要先在华为云官方网站注册,注册过程中需要提供有效的电子邮件地址、手机号码等信息,并且按照提示完成身份验证步骤。
- 注册成功后,可以登录到华为云控制台,对云服务器等资源进行管理。
2、创建云服务器实例
- 在登录华为云控制台后,进入云服务器管理页面,创建云服务器实例。
- 在创建过程中,需要选择合适的操作系统(如Linux的Ubuntu、CentOS等或者Windows Server)、实例规格(根据计算资源需求选择,如CPU核心数、内存大小等)、存储容量等参数。
- 要设置好网络配置,包括虚拟私有云(VPC)、子网、安全组等,安全组规则非常重要,它决定了哪些网络流量可以进出云服务器,如果要使用Cloud Shell登录,需要确保安全组允许SSH(对于Linux服务器)或RDP(对于Windows服务器)的入站流量。
四、使用Cloud Shell登录华为云服务器的具体步骤
1、登录华为云控制台
- 打开浏览器,输入华为云官方网址,使用注册的账号登录到华为云控制台。
2、进入Cloud Shell界面
- 在华为云控制台界面中,找到Cloud Shell入口,通常可以在控制台的右上角或者侧边栏中找到相关图标或菜单选项。
- 点击进入Cloud Shell后,系统会为用户分配一个临时的命令行环境。
3、连接云服务器
- 对于linux云服务器
- 如果是Linux云服务器,首先需要获取云服务器的公网IP地址,可以在云服务器实例的详细信息页面中找到。
- 在Cloud Shell中,输入命令“ssh username@ip_address”,username”是云服务器上的用户名(在创建云服务器实例时设置或者系统默认的用户名,如Ubuntu系统默认的“ubuntu”),“ip_address”就是刚刚获取的公网IP地址。
- 然后按照提示输入密码(如果设置了密码登录)或者使用密钥登录(如果在创建云服务器实例时配置了密钥对)。
- 对于Windows云服务器
- 对于Windows云服务器,需要确保已经在云服务器上开启了远程桌面服务(RDP),并且安全组允许RDP的入站流量。
- 在Cloud Shell中无法直接使用RDP协议登录Windows云服务器,但可以先使用一些工具,如“rdesktop”(如果Cloud Shell环境支持安装额外工具的话),不过,更常见的做法是使用本地的远程桌面客户端(如Windows系统自带的“mstsc.exe”),通过在本地输入云服务器的公网IP地址、用户名和密码进行登录。
在Cloud Shell中操作云服务器
1、基本的命令操作(针对Linux云服务器)
文件管理
- 使用“ls”命令可以查看当前目录下的文件和目录列表。“ls -l”可以以详细列表的形式显示文件的权限、所有者、大小、创建时间等信息。
- “cd”命令用于切换目录,如“cd /home”可以进入“home”目录。
- 如果要创建新的目录,可以使用“mkdir”命令,如“mkdir new_folder”。
软件安装与管理
- 对于基于Debian或Ubuntu的系统,使用“apt - get”命令来安装软件,要安装“nginx”服务器,可以输入“sudo apt - get install nginx”。
- 对于基于CentOS或Red Hat的系统,使用“yum”命令,如“sudo yum install httpd”来安装“httpd”服务。
进程管理
- 使用“ps”命令可以查看当前运行的进程。“ps -ef”可以显示所有进程的详细信息。
- 如果要终止一个进程,可以使用“kill”命令,首先使用“ps”命令找到要终止进程的PID(进程标识符),然后输入“kill PID”来终止该进程。
2、管理Windows云服务器(通过本地远程桌面客户端登录后)
系统管理
- 可以在“控制面板”中进行各种系统设置,如管理用户账户、设置网络连接、调整显示设置等。
- 使用“计算机管理”工具,可以管理磁盘、服务、用户组等资源,可以查看磁盘的使用情况,启动或停止服务等。
软件安装与卸载
- 在Windows云服务器上安装软件,可以通过下载安装程序(如.exe文件),然后双击运行安装程序,按照提示完成安装过程。
- 要卸载软件,可以通过“控制面板”中的“程序和功能”,找到要卸载的软件,然后点击“卸载”按钮进行卸载。
注意事项
1、安全方面
- 定期更新云服务器上的操作系统和软件,以修复安全漏洞,对于Linux系统,可以使用“apt - get update”和“apt - get upgrade”(对于Ubuntu等系统)或者“yum update”(对于CentOS等系统)命令来更新系统。
- 合理设置安全组规则,只开放必要的端口,如果只需要通过Cloud Shell登录进行管理操作,只需要开放SSH(对于Linux)或RDP(对于Windows)端口,并且限制访问源为可信的IP地址范围。
- 对于使用密码登录的情况,要设置强密码,包含字母、数字和特殊字符,并且定期更换密码。
2、资源管理方面
- 监控云服务器的资源使用情况,如CPU、内存、磁盘和网络带宽的使用情况,在华为云控制台中,可以找到相关的监控工具,如果发现资源使用率过高,可以考虑升级实例规格或者优化应用程序的性能。
- 对于存储资源,要合理规划磁盘空间的使用,可以定期清理不需要的文件和日志,以释放磁盘空间。
3、操作规范方面
- 在使用Cloud Shell进行操作时,要小心执行命令,尤其是一些具有破坏性的命令,如“rm -rf”命令,如果误操作可能会导致数据丢失,在执行重要命令之前,最好先备份相关数据或者在测试环境中进行验证。
- 对于Windows云服务器,在安装软件时要注意软件的兼容性,避免安装不兼容的软件导致系统故障。
通过以上步骤和注意事项,用户可以较为顺利地使用Cloud Shell登录华为云服务器,并进行有效的管理和操作,无论是开发人员进行应用程序部署,还是企业管理员进行服务器维护,Cloud Shell都提供了一种便捷、安全的登录和操作方式,随着云计算技术的不断发展,华为云服务器以及其相关的管理工具如Cloud Shell将在更多的场景中发挥重要的作用,为用户提供高效、可靠的计算资源管理解决方案。
本文链接:https://www.zhitaoyun.cn/119530.html
发表评论